#ifndef SENSOR_ADAPTER_H
#define SENSOR_ADAPTER_H
#include <memory>
#include <string>
namespace OHOS::NWeb {
enum {
SENSOR_ERROR = -1,
SENSOR_SUCCESS = 0,
SENSOR_PERMISSION_DENIED = 201,
SENSOR_PARAMETER_ERROR = 401,
SENSOR_SERVICE_EXCEPTION = 14500101,
SENSOR_NO_SUPPORT = 14500102,
SENSOR_NON_SYSTEM_API = 202
};
enum {
SENSOR_DATA_REPORT_ON_CHANGE = 0,
SENSOR_DATA_REPORT_CONTINUOUS = 1
};
class SensorCallbackAdapter {
public:
virtual ~SensorCallbackAdapter() = default;
virtual void UpdateOhosSensorData(double timestamp,
double value1, double value2, double value3, double value4) = 0;
};
class SensorAdapter {
public:
SensorAdapter() = default;
virtual ~SensorAdapter() = default;
virtual int32_t IsOhosSensorSupported(int32_t sensorTypeId) = 0;
virtual int32_t GetOhosSensorReportingMode(int32_t sensorTypeId) = 0;
virtual double GetOhosSensorDefaultSupportedFrequency(int32_t sensorTypeId) = 0;
virtual double GetOhosSensorMinSupportedFrequency(int32_t sensorTypeId) = 0;
virtual double GetOhosSensorMaxSupportedFrequency(int32_t sensorTypeId) = 0;
virtual int32_t SubscribeOhosSensor(int32_t sensorTypeId, int64_t samplingInterval) = 0;
virtual int32_t RegistOhosSensorCallback(int32_t sensorTypeId,
std::shared_ptr<SensorCallbackAdapter> callbackAdapter) = 0;
virtual int32_t UnsubscribeOhosSensor(int32_t sensorTypeId) = 0;
};
}
#endif
